Why Validation Messages?
When you use Solution Launchpad, whether you are installing, exporting, or re-syncing your bundles and items you may see a validation message causing your desired action to fail. While these messages don't occur often, we have them in place to ensure that our Partners can create solutions that will install in users apps and work as the partner intended it to.
The table below shows you the most common validation messages, where they are most likely to occur, what they mean, and what your next steps should be to resolve the issue.

| Source Tenant Matches Destination | ✅
|
|
|
Install into the same app where the content came from. Not allowed due to conflicts with resource tracking. | Make sure you aren’t installing your solution into the original app. A bundle can contain items from multiple source apps, if any item in the bundle originated in the destination, the entire bundle will fail to install. |
| Conflicting Tracked Resources | ✅
|
|
|
Multiple versions of the same item exist in a bundle, due to edited resources being re-exported independently. In order to avoid creating duplicates, Solution Launchpad does not allow the install to continue. Resolved by the user running a Sync on their end. | Log into your SLP account, locate the bundle and run a Sync on your bundle or resource. All items and their dependencies in the bundle will be updated to their latest versions from your source app(s). |

| Bulk Validation Failure | ✅
|
|
|
Working as intended with a clear, helpful error. This happens in 2 scenarios:
1. When you exceed allowed limits on custom fields (contact, company & affiliates are the 3 we check for now) 2. When a custom field in the bundle matches an existing custom field’s name/ID, but with a different data type. (e.g. existing field is a date, installing field is a drop-down) |
Ensure that your solution will not be putting your client over their limits on custom fields, contacts, etc.
An admin in the destination app must delete the number of custom fields (of the same type) before the solution can be installed. An admin in the destination app must delete the conflicting field. Alternatively, the partner can remove the field where it’s referenced in the solution, sync it in Solution Launchpad, then re-attempt the install. |

| Shared Resource Not Found | ✅
|
✅
|
✅
|
Notifies the user that the resource is missing and their request cannot continue. | This may happen on install if a resource that you previously shared has been deleted from your app. You will need to re-export the resource in this case. This may happen on export in limited edge cases. In this case, try refreshing and beginning your export again, and contact support if the issue persists. |
| Re-sharing Forbidden |
|
✅
|
✅
|
This content isn’t tracked back to your primary app. You will not be able to share content installed to your app(s) by other partners. | We intentionally protect the IP of other partners and users by not allowing the unauthorized sharing of assets. You may also see this error when you’ve installed an item via your legacy marketplace company - if you believe this is the case, please contact support for options. |
| Required Item Not Found |
|
✅
|
✅ | Notifies the exporting user that a necessary dependency of the item(s) being shared is missing, and that is preventing a successful export. | You must recreate and/or reattach the dependency and retry your export. The error message contains a helpful “path to item” showing where the dependency is referenced. |
